The RCIPS is the single, national police force for the UK Overseas Territory of the Cayman Islands, standing at 343 enlisted officers and 64 civilians strong, and serving 60,000 residents and 2 million annual visitors across three islands.My Role: Directed all communications and media relations for the department. Supervised two direct reports.STRATEGIC ADVISING– Advised the Commissioner of Police and executive police leadership (Senior Command Team) on strategic and crisis communications, and sensitive situations of reputational vulnerability.– Developed a communications strategy to promote the image and brand of the police service and its relaunched Community Policing Program, through media outreach, community engagement, and an expanded digital and social media presence. COMMUNICATIONS– Produced communications policies and procedures that improved the accuracy, consistency and presentation of police information provided to the media and public.– Initiated crisis communications protocols for major crime incidents, reputational controversies, and natural disaster scenarios that improved responsiveness and mitigated public concern.– Led effective recruitment and public safety campaigns in both paid and unpaid media.MEDIA RELATIONS– Generated hundreds of press releases and created a manual to regularize information release.– Acted as press spokesperson in regular appearances on television and radio, and managed all media appearances and press conferences of Senior Command.– Conducted media training to increase the diversity of officers in the media.– Built resilient partnerships with journalists that produced more balanced coverage of police issues.DIGITAL– Developed and launched a new organizational website (www.rcips.ky), including a mobile app with varied functionalities, including public safety, crime and traffic alerts, and administrative form submissions.– Hired and managed web site development contractors and managed the project budget.

The Mission’s top priority is to facilitate a comprehensive settlement of the Transdniestrian conflict through peaceful negotiations, based on the sovereignty and territorial integrity of the Republic of Moldova, with a special status for Transdniestria within Moldova.ADVISING AND MEDIATION – Acted as the Head of Mission’s (a US Ambassador) main liaison with government partners, civil society, Transdniestrian authorities, and community activists on hotly-contested human rights and minority rights issues.– Identified areas of consensus and potential compromise, and recommended advocacy strategies to the Head of Mission.- Mediated emerging disputes with government partners and civil society representatives.– Researched and produced a document with international experts assessing both sides of a longstanding dispute on language rights, which served as a cornerstone negotiation instrument on the issue.PROGRAM MANAGEMENT – Managed multiple simultaneous projects on detention monitoring, language rights, and the improvement of internal disciplinary procedures for the Ministry of Interior (police);- Led project implementation teams, including the hiring and supervision of contracted partners, and conducted evaluation and monitoring.– Supervised a unit of three local staff and managed a programmatic budget of two hundred thousand euro ($224,000 USD).

The OSCE Office in Baku was established in 1999 with a mandate to assist the Azerbaijani government fulfill its OSCE commitments to human rights, the rule of law and democratic institutions.My role: Developing and directing the Office’s policy, projects, and advocacy on all democratization issues, including media freedom and elections, in a tense and restricted political and media environment.ADVISING AND LEGISLATIVE ADVOCACY– Advised the Head of Office (a Turkish ambassador) on stakeholder engagement and advocacy strategies with the host government, independent media, civil society, diplomats and opposition politicians.– Coordinated the drafting of legislative proposals on domestic violence (DV), the decriminalization of defamation, and election administration, together with civil society experts.– Organized Office advocacy for promoting these proposals with parliament and government, which resulted in the passage of the new DV law.PROGRAM MANAGEMENT– Supervised wide-ranging projects across the country to strengthen media freedom and access to information, improve the transparency and fairness of election process, and increase the participation of women in civic life. - Managed a staff of four and several contracted partners in the development and execution of these projects, implementing four hundred thousand euro ($456,000 USD annually.– Conducted close monitoring and evaluation to develop programmatic objectives in line with country needs.

The State Bar of California is the licensing body for California attorneys, and the Enforcement Unit investigates complaints and prosecutes attorneys for violations of the California Rules of Professional Conduct and Business and Professions Code. My Role: Conducted complex disciplinary investigations into serious allegations of attorney misconduct, including misappropriation, fraud, reckless failures to perform, and prosecutorial misconduct. – Coordinated with district attorneys’ offices on complex fraud investigations referred for criminal prosecution, and gave testimony in court.– Where allegations were not substantiated, mediated disputes and resolutions between attorneys and clients.– Assisted in public outreach and education initiatives regarding the mission of the State Bar and the restitution available to victims through the Client Security Fund.
